I got my start as a woodturner making lamps for a custom lampshade artist. They are easy and fun to make, give you a chance to hone your spindle skills, and the design possibilities are endless. A lamp auger is handy for drilling the hole if you are using solid wood, and the only wiring you need to know is how to tie the Underwriter's knot. I used to browse through stores ranging from Target and Kmart to lamp specialty shops for inspiration. I can't imagine being a woodturner and not having at least a couple turned lamps in the house (as well as a kitchen cabinet stocked with turned plates and bowls). They should be an essential on every turner's project list.
